The Outcome
Scape emerged with a clearer, more confident brand strategy and identity that unified Arc and Lungfish under a customer-focused offer. Marketing campaigns became more effective and efficient, supported by new templates and processes. Internally, the culture work gave employees a stronger sense of connection to the brand, and externally, customers experienced a more consistent and compelling story — setting Scape up to grow with clarity and confidence in a competitive market.
The Approach
OOver 12 months I worked hands-on with the executive team and marketing function. This included stakeholder workshops, customer research, and leadership sessions to clarify brand positioning and align the Group brand. I created a marketing campaign playbook, introduced new briefing tools, and supported the launch of a refreshed visual identity. Alongside this, I partnered with HR to design internal culture campaigns, embed brand values, and strengthen employee engagement.
The Challenge
Scape, a leading provider of compliant built environment frameworks, wanted to sharpen its brand positioning and marketing in a shifting market.
The Chief Strategy Officer, Chief People Officer, and Marketing Director asked me to bring clarity across the Group and its portfolio brands, while also connecting the work to culture, EVP, and customer experience.
